Understanding CPR: A Lifesaving Technique

What is CPR?

CPR means Cardiopulmonary Resuscitation, a vital emergency treatment made use of when someone's heart stops beating or when they quit taking a breath. It entails breast compressions and rescue breaths aimed at maintaining blood circulation and oxygenation up until specialist aid arrives.

How to Perform CPR: Step-by-Step Guide

Check Responsiveness: Gently tremble the person's shoulders and shout loudly. Call for Help: If unresponsive, call emergency situation services immediately. Open Airway: Tilt the head back somewhat while lifting the chin. Check Breathing: Search for normal breathing (not wheezing). Start Breast Compressions: Location hands on the facility of the chest and press hard and fast (at least 100-120 compressions per min). Rescue Breaths: After every 30 compressions, offer two rescue breaths if trained. Continue Up until Aid Arrives: Maintain carrying out until emergency situation -responders take over.

AED Exactly how to Use: A Vital Skill in Emergencies

What is an AED?

An AED (Automated External Defibrillator) is a mobile tool that supplies an electric shock to bring back normal heart rhythm during heart arrest.

Using AED with CPR Australia

Turn on the AED. Apply pads as suggested on the device. Follow audio/visual motivates supplied by the AED. Continue with CPR till emergency personnel arrive.

Infant mouth-to-mouth resuscitation Method: Special Considerations

Performing mouth-to-mouth resuscitation on infants calls for unique techniques as a result of their breakable physiology:

    Use 2 fingers for breast compressions. Keep compression deepness about 1.5 inches. Administer mild rescue breaths covering both nostrils and mouth.

CPR for Drowning Sufferers: Special Technique Needed

Drowning victims need prompt rescue breaths complied with by upper body compressions right away given that their key issue is normally absence of oxygen rather than cardiac failing initially.
